Great blend of economy, luxury, comfort, practicality and looks

I've had this car for nearly 2 months now after switching from an Audi A3 quattro. The CC is a big step up in luxury and it is exceptionally quiet on the go. I deliberately chose the 1.8 petrol over the diesel options as I wanted to avoid the risks of DMF, EGR and other problems that the 2.0 tdi can entail, not to mention turbo issues too which can afflict that engine. The petrol turbo does offer low down torque in a similar way to the tdi, but is smoother and has a greater rev range. Sounds better too.

I find the CC quite practical, with a huge boot (full size spare contained neatly within). My car is equipped with nappa leather, park assist and heated seats, which are nice options. Parking sensors front and rear are a must. Not so impressed with the touch screen radio/CD on the move though, although the sound quality is great. Cannot change CD via the steering wheel buttons it seems.

Economy wise, the trip computer is reporting anything from 37 to 47 mpg. I will calculate the true mpg after a few more fill ups, and I expect it to be slightly lower than reported by the computer. That said, petrol is at least 5p cheaper at the pumps than diesel at the moment, so for me the running costs are comparable to my old A3 tdi as I'm not clocking up mega miles.

The CC is great value for money second hand, maybe due to the lack of a fifth seat? I'm happy with my choice of this over another Audi for example. It's definitely not a common sight on our roads in comparison.
